Namastay- central Glastonbury
Welcome to the ancient Isle of Avalon
Home
Overview
Availability
Contact
Map
Gallery
Reviews
▾
Book Now
Home
Overview
Availability
Contact
Map
Gallery
Reviews
▾
Reviews